Employee background checks are a critical part of the hiring process, enabling organizations to verify the accuracy of a candidate’s information and assess potential risks. These checks typically include identity verification, education verification, employment history validation, criminal record screening, address verification, and reference checks. Depending on the role and industry, employers may also conduct credit checks, global database screening, or compliance-related verifications. Background checks are especially important in sectors like finance, healthcare, IT, and logistics, where trust, data security, and regulatory compliance are essential.By conducting thorough background checks, employers can detect discrepancies in resumes, identify fraudulent claims, and reduce the risk of negligent hiring. It also helps create a safer workplace and builds trust among employees, customers, and stakeholders. With advancements in technology, many companies now rely on automated and API-based verification solutions to speed up the process while maintaining accuracy. A well-structured employee background check process not only protects organizations but also supports better hiring decisions and long-term workforce reliability.
